Consider a piece of equipment that initially cost $8,000 and has these estimated annual expenses and MV: End of Annual Year, k Expenses 1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 $3,000 3,000 3,500 4,000 4,500 5,250 6,250 7,750 MV at End of Year $4,700 3,200 2,200 1,450 950 600 300 0 If the after-tax MARR is 7% per year, determine the after-tax economic life of this equipment. MACRS (GDS) depreciation is being used (five-year property class). The effective income tax rate is 40%.
